【超能数据抓取】Hyper Fetch:现代Web开发的高效数据交换利器
在快节奏的Web开发领域,寻找一个既能简化数据获取过程又能无缝整合实时交互功能的框架成为了一项挑战。今天,我们为您隆重介绍——Hyper Fetch,一个专为追求效率和简洁性的开发者设计的全新开源项目。
项目介绍
Hyper Fetch 是一个前沿的数据获取与实时数据交流框架,其核心在于使数据处理变得前所未有的简单而高效。它不仅完美兼容前端与后端环境,而且通过类型安全的设计理念,确保了开发者在速度与稳定性的双重保障下进行构建。
技术深度解析
Hyper Fetch采用了现代化的技术栈,强调响应式编程模型,使得请求生命周期管理变得直观且强大。其内建的智能特性如自动取消重复请求、队列管理以及响应缓存,大大优化了资源利用,减少了不必要的网络负担。特别是它的智能重试机制和离线工作模式,即使在网络不稳定的情况下也能保证应用流畅运行,展现了它对于复杂场景的强大适应性。
应用场景广泛
无论是构建高度互动的Web应用,实时更新的新闻平台,还是要求即时反馈的社交网络,Hyper Fetch都是理想选择。其与React生态的紧密结合,意味着在构建现代单页应用时能够更加得心应手,同时,通过WebSocket支持,轻松实现前后端实时通信,比如股票交易系统、在线协作工具等。
项目亮点
- 简易部署与快速上手:详细的文档与快速入门指南让开发者可以迅速启动项目。
- 智能请求管理:自动识别并合并相似的请求,减少服务器压力。
- 完整的生命周期控制:从发起请求到接收响应,每一步都可被精确控制。
- 灵活的缓存策略:提升应用性能,减少不必要的网络请求。
- 离线支持:增强用户体验,确保无网状态下的可用性。
- 强大的适配器系统:包括但不限于对GraphQL、Firebase、Axios的支持,满足多样化的后端需求。
结语
Hyper Fetch以其精巧的设计、强大的功能和易于集成的特点,无疑将成为下一代Web应用中不可或缺的一员。无论你是初创项目寻求高效解决方案,还是成熟团队希望优化现有架构,Hyper Fetch都值得一试。立即开始探索,解锁数据交换的新可能,体验超乎想象的开发效率提升。前往官方文档深入了解,并通过GitHub加入这一创新之旅,共建更美好的Web开发环境。